Why Kitchen Water Damage Is Uniquely Destructive

Your kitchen concentrates more water sources into a smaller area than any other room in your home. The dishwasher, refrigerator ice maker, sink supply lines, garbage disposal, and sometimes a secondary water heater all run within a few square feet of each other. When one of these systems fails, water floods an area packed with expensive finishes, custom cabinetry, countertops, and appliances worth tens of thousands of dollars.

Unlike a bathroom designed to handle some moisture exposure, kitchens are built with materials that absorb water aggressively. Particleboard cabinet boxes, hardwood flooring, paper-faced drywall behind sinks, and decorative toe kicks all soak up water like sponges. The damage path in a kitchen also travels fast because water follows gravity under cabinets, behind appliances, and down into the subflooring where it pools invisibly.

Common Causes of Kitchen Water Damage in Georgia Homes

After a decade of restoring kitchens across metro Atlanta, we see the same failure points over and over. Knowing what caused your damage helps us target extraction and helps your insurance adjuster classify the claim correctly.

  • Dishwasher supply line failure: The braided stainless steel or rubber hose connecting your dishwasher to the hot water supply is the single most common source of catastrophic kitchen flooding we respond to. These hoses degrade over 5 to 8 years and often burst without warning, releasing pressurized water directly onto your subflooring.
  • Refrigerator ice maker line leak: The quarter-inch copper or plastic tubing running to your refrigerator's ice maker frequently develops pinhole leaks or pulls loose from compression fittings. These leaks are deceptive. they can run for hours behind the refrigerator before water migrates out where you can see it, saturating the wall cavity and subflooring behind the unit.
  • Sink drain or supply failure: Corroded P-traps, failed garbage disposal seals, and deteriorated supply line connections under the kitchen sink create slow leaks that saturate the cabinet base and spread to adjacent cabinetry. By the time most homeowners notice the swollen cabinet bottom, the damage has already spread to surrounding floor joists.
  • Garbage disposal seal failure: The mounting flange between the disposal and the sink basin develops cracks or the rubber gasket deteriorates, allowing rinse water to drip directly into the cabinet cavity below. In a humid Georgia kitchen, this enclosed, dark space becomes a mold incubator within days.
  • Roof leak above the kitchen: Atlanta's severe thunderstorms, including the straight-line wind events that hit north metro counties several times each summer, drive rain under compromised flashing and through degraded roof penetrations. When the leak path routes through a kitchen ceiling, it damages not just the ceiling drywall but everything below. lighting fixtures, countertops, cabinet interiors, and appliances.   • Burst pipe in the wall behind the kitchen: Supply lines running through interior walls to the kitchen sink or dishwasher can burst during winter cold snaps. Atlanta occasionally drops into the low 20s. or simply fail from age and corrosion. A burst pipe behind a kitchen wall floods the wall cavity, soaks insulation, and sends water cascading down to the floor level before any visible sign appears on the wall surface.

Kitchen Cabinet Water Damage: When to Salvage and When to Replace

Cabinets are the most expensive element at risk in a kitchen flood. A full set of custom cabinets in an Atlanta luxury kitchen can run $30,000 to $80,000 or more. The decision to salvage or replace depends on the cabinet construction material, the duration of water exposure, and the contamination category of the water involved.

Solid hardwood cabinets. including maple, cherry, oak, and walnut. can often be saved if we reach them within the first 24 hours. Wood absorbs water but also releases it under controlled drying conditions. We remove doors and drawers, extract water from the cabinet box interiors, position air movers to circulate air through the empty cavities, and monitor moisture content daily until readings drop below 15%. Once dry, the cabinets can be lightly sanded and refinished if the water caused surface staining.

Particleboard and MDF cabinets. which make up the majority of builder-grade and many mid-range cabinet installations. swell irreversibly once saturated. The wood particles separate from the binding resin, and no amount of drying restores the original density or structural integrity. If your particleboard cabinet bases, shelves, or sides have swollen, they require replacement. There is no shortcut around this physical reality.

Thermofoil and laminate door faces on particleboard substrates are especially vulnerable. The vinyl or laminate layer traps moisture against the particleboard core, accelerating swelling and delamination. We frequently see thermofoil doors that look fine from the front but have completely delaminated from the back within 48 hours of water exposure.

Kitchen Flooring Damage: Material-by-Material Restoration

Kitchen flooring takes the brunt of every water event because gravity concentrates all leaked and extracted water at floor level. The restoration approach depends entirely on what flooring material you have installed and how the subfloor beneath it has responded to the water.

Hardwood flooring in a kitchen is a significant investment and a common feature in Atlanta's upscale homes throughout Alpharetta, Roswell, and Marietta. Hardwood absorbs water from both the top surface and the bottom through the subfloor. Minor exposure. a few hours. typically causes cupping that can be dried flat with commercial dehumidifiers and weighted air movers. Extended exposure beyond 12 to 24 hours causes permanent buckling, crown, and structural weakening that requires board replacement and refinishing of the entire affected area to achieve a color and sheen match.

Luxury vinyl plank (LVP) is more water-resistant than hardwood at the surface level, but water that penetrates seams or edges pools between the LVP and the subfloor. Because LVP acts as a vapor barrier, this trapped water cannot evaporate upward and instead saturates the plywood or OSB subfloor beneath. We remove affected LVP sections to expose and dry the subfloor directly, then reinstall matching planks once drying is confirmed.

Tile and stone flooring resists water damage at the surface, but grout joints are porous and allow water to wick through to the mortar bed and subfloor below. In a heavy kitchen flood, tile floors frequently look fine on top while the subfloor underneath is saturated and softening. We use moisture meters to check subfloor readings through grout joints and, when necessary, remove tile sections to access and dry the substrate before mold takes hold.

The subfloor itself. typically 3/4-inch plywood or OSB in Georgia construction. is the foundation under every finished floor. When subfloor moisture content exceeds 19%, delamination and structural weakening accelerate rapidly. OSB is particularly vulnerable because the oriented strand layers separate when saturated, and unlike plywood, OSB rarely regains full structural capacity after extended water exposure. We test subfloor readings at multiple points and replace any sections that have lost structural integrity.

Mold Behind Kitchen Cabinets: Georgia's Hidden Threat

The space behind and beneath kitchen cabinets is the single most dangerous zone for mold growth after a kitchen water event. These enclosed cavities are dark, warm, and receive no airflow. the exact conditions mold needs to thrive. In Georgia's subtropical climate, these conditions combine with ambient humidity to create a mold timeline that moves faster than most homeowners realize.

Within 24 hours: Mold spores. which are always present in indoor air. land on wet organic surfaces and begin germinating. The paper backing on drywall behind cabinets, the raw wood of cabinet backs, and the dust layer on subflooring all provide the nutrients mold needs to activate.

Within 48 hours: Mold colonies begin forming. At this stage, you may smell a musty odor but see nothing visible because the growth is happening behind the cabinet backs and on the wall surface you cannot see without pulling the cabinets.

Within 72 hours: Visible mold growth appears on accessible surfaces. Behind cabinets, the growth is already advanced. Stachybotrys (black mold), Aspergillus, and Penicillium are the most common species we identify in Georgia kitchen water damage situations. At this point, the restoration scope has expanded from water damage cleanup to full mold remediation. a significantly more expensive and time-consuming project.

This timeline is why our extraction process specifically targets the cabinet cavities and wall spaces behind kitchen installations. We pull base cabinets away from walls where necessary, remove wet drywall sections behind them, treat exposed framing with antimicrobial solution, and position drying equipment to circulate air through these critical cavities. The goal is simple: dry everything below the mold growth threshold before the 24-hour clock runs out.

If mold has already established itself. which we determine through visual inspection and air quality testing. we follow IICRC S520 mold remediation standards, including containment barriers, negative air pressure, HEPA filtration, and antimicrobial treatment of all affected structural surfaces. Kitchen Appliance Water Damage: Save or Replace

High-end kitchen appliances represent a major investment. Sub-Zero refrigerators, Wolf ranges, Miele dishwashers, and similar premium units found in Atlanta's luxury homes carry price tags from $3,000 to $15,000 per unit. When water damage strikes, the question of appliance salvage versus replacement requires both technical assessment and strategic insurance documentation.

Refrigerators: Water damage to the compressor compartment, electrical connections, or control boards typically renders the unit unsafe and uneconomical to repair. The compressor area sits at floor level. exactly where floodwater pools deepest. If water reached the compressor housing, we document the water line height and recommend replacement for safety and insurance purposes.

Dishwashers: Ironically, the appliance designed to use water is often the most damaged by external flooding. Water entering the motor compartment, circuit board housing, or insulation jacket from outside creates electrical safety hazards and corrosion that manufacturers will not warranty. If floodwater entered the unit from outside. as opposed to a supply line leak inside the unit. replacement is almost always the correct call.

Ranges and cooktops: Gas ranges with electronic ignition and electric ranges with digital controls are both vulnerable to water damage in the wiring harness and control module areas. If standing water reached the electrical components, we document and recommend replacement. Gas appliances that have been submerged also require gas line integrity verification before any reconnection.

Built-in microwaves and vent hoods: Water infiltrating through the ceiling above these units. common during roof leak events. corrodes internal wiring and creates short circuit risks. These are documenting-and-replacing situations, not repair opportunities.

Filing Insurance Claims for Kitchen Water Damage in Georgia

Kitchen water damage claims are among the most common. and most disputed. residential insurance claims in Georgia. The average kitchen water damage claim we handle ranges from $8,000 for a contained dishwasher leak to over $100,000 for a catastrophic supply line failure in a high-end kitchen. Getting your claim paid in full requires proper documentation from the first minute.

Here is what your insurance company will evaluate and how we protect your interests at each step:

  • Cause of loss classification: Insurers distinguish between sudden/accidental damage (covered) and gradual/maintenance-related damage (often denied). We document the failure point. the burst hose, the cracked fitting, the failed seal. with close-up photographs and written descriptions that establish the sudden nature of the event.
  • Scope of damage documentation: We map moisture readings throughout the affected area, photograph every damaged surface and component, and create a room-by-room inventory of damaged items. This documentation package is formatted for adjuster review and leaves no room for scope disputes.
  • Mitigation compliance: Your policy requires you to take reasonable steps to prevent further damage. By calling us for emergency extraction within hours, you are meeting this obligation. We provide timestamped records of our mitigation efforts that prove you acted promptly and responsibly.

Professional Structural Drying for Atlanta Kitchens

Structural drying is the phase between emergency water extraction and rebuild. It is the most technically demanding part of the restoration process and the step that determines whether your kitchen needs partial repairs or a full gut renovation. In Georgia's climate, professional drying is not optional. it is mandatory.

Our structural drying protocol for kitchen water damage follows IICRC S500 standards and includes these specific steps:

  1. Initial psychrometric readings: We measure temperature, humidity, and dew point throughout the kitchen and adjacent rooms. These baseline readings establish the drying environment and help us calculate equipment requirements. Georgia's average indoor relative humidity of 50-60% during summer means we often need to achieve a net drying effect against significant ambient moisture.
  2. Equipment placement: Commercial-grade dehumidifiers rated for 30+ pints per day are positioned based on the volume of the affected space. High-velocity air movers are angled at 15-degree angles against walls and into cabinet cavities to maximize evaporation from saturated materials. The ratio of air movers to dehumidifiers follows IICRC guidelines for the specific material types affected.
  3. Daily moisture monitoring: We return daily to record moisture meter readings at multiple mapped points. This monitoring produces a drying curve that shows the rate of moisture reduction over time. If the curve flattens before reaching target readings. below 15% for wood, below 1% for concrete. we adjust equipment placement and quantity.
  4. Cabinet-specific drying: For salvageable wood cabinets, we remove doors and drawers, drill ventilation holes in enclosed spaces where necessary, and direct airflow through cabinet box interiors. This aggressive but controlled approach dries the wood without causing the checking and splitting that uncontrolled heat drying produces.
  5. Final verification: Drying is not complete until all mapped points read at or below target moisture content for their material type. We provide a final moisture map and drying certificate that documents the kitchen has returned to acceptable moisture levels. a document your insurance company and any future home inspector will want to see.

The typical drying cycle for kitchen water damage in the Atlanta metro area runs 3 to 5 days. Heavy saturation of subflooring and wall cavities during summer months can extend this to 7 days. We never rush the drying phase because premature closure of walls and cabinets over damp materials is the number one cause of post-restoration mold callbacks in our industry.

Kitchen Rebuild and Restoration After Water Damage

Once extraction and drying are complete, the rebuild phase restores your kitchen to pre-loss condition. or better, if you choose to upgrade materials during the process. Our restoration crews handle every trade required to complete the rebuild, eliminating the need for you to coordinate multiple contractors.

Drywall replacement: We remove and replace all drywall sections that were cut for drying access or that sustained irreversible water damage. New drywall is taped, mudded, and finished to match the existing wall texture. In kitchens with tile backsplashes, we carefully remove and reinstall backsplash tile at the drywall transition points.

Cabinet replacement and reinstallation: When cabinets require replacement, we source matching or equivalent units and install them to the same specifications as the original installation. For custom cabinetry that cannot be matched from stock, we work with local cabinet shops to produce custom replacements. Insurance policies typically cover replacement with like kind and quality.

Flooring reinstallation: Whether hardwood, LVP, tile, or stone, we reinstall flooring to match the existing installation. For hardwood, this includes color matching, staining, and finishing to blend with adjacent undamaged areas. For tile, we source matching tile and grout to achieve a consistent appearance.

Countertop and fixture restoration: Granite, quartz, and marble countertops are generally water-resistant but the seams, sink cutouts, and undermount brackets can allow water penetration that loosens adhesives and damages the substrate beneath. We inspect all countertop connection points and reseal or replace as needed.

Appliance reconnection: All appliances are reconnected by licensed technicians. Gas appliances undergo leak testing before operation. Electrical appliances are tested on dedicated circuits. New supply lines and drain connections are installed where the originals failed.

Georgia building codes require permits for certain kitchen restoration work, including electrical and plumbing modifications. We pull all required permits and schedule inspections so your rebuild meets current code requirements. which also protects you when selling the home and during future insurance applications.

Kitchen Water Damage Restoration: Frequently Asked Questions

Can water-damaged kitchen cabinets be saved or do they need replacement?

It depends on the cabinet material and exposure time. Solid wood cabinets (maple, cherry, oak) can often be dried and refinished if we reach them within 24 hours. Particleboard and MDF cabinets swell permanently once saturated and require replacement. We assess each cabinet individually with moisture meters so you only replace what is truly beyond repair. Our documentation ensures your insurance pays for every unit that needs replacing.

How quickly does mold grow under kitchen cabinets after a leak?

In Georgia's 70%+ humidity, mold spores activate on wet surfaces within 24 hours. By 48 hours, colonies form on organic materials behind and beneath cabinets. areas you cannot see without pulling the cabinets. At 72 hours, visible mold growth is established. This is why we specifically target the hidden spaces behind kitchen installations during emergency extraction. Waiting even one extra day can turn a water damage cleanup into a full mold remediation project.

Does insurance cover kitchen water damage from appliance failures?

Most Georgia homeowners policies cover sudden and accidental water damage from appliance failures. dishwasher supply line bursts, refrigerator ice maker line leaks, garbage disposal failures. The key factor is sudden versus gradual. Insurers deny claims they classify as deferred maintenance. We document every job with timestamped photos, moisture readings, and detailed reports structured specifically for adjuster review to establish the sudden nature of the event.

How long does kitchen water damage restoration take?

Emergency extraction takes 2 to 4 hours. Structural drying runs 3 to 5 days, sometimes up to 7 in heavy saturation during Georgia's humid summer months. If cabinets, flooring, or drywall require replacement, the rebuild adds 1 to 3 weeks depending on scope and material availability. We provide a detailed timeline after our initial moisture mapping so you know exactly what to expect.

Should I remove wet materials before the restoration crew arrives?

No. Do not remove any materials before we arrive and document the damage. Pulling up flooring or removing cabinets before documentation can jeopardize your insurance claim. the adjuster needs to see the original damage extent. Georgia's persistent humidity. averaging above 70% from May through September. makes kitchen water damage worse than the same event would be in a dry climate like Arizona or Colorado. Wet materials in a Georgia kitchen do not dry on their own. They stay wet, and mold colonizes them. Professional extraction and structural drying equipment is the only reliable path to saving your kitchen from becoming a mold remediation project.
